Choosing the Right Camping Shower

Considerations for Portable Showers

When choosing a portable shower for your camping trip, there are several factors to consider. First, think about the size and weight of the shower. You want something that is lightweight and compact, so it's easy to transport and store. Additionally, consider the water capacity of the shower. How many gallons of water can it hold? This will determine how long you can shower before needing to refill. Another important consideration is the water source. Some portable showers require a water hookup, while others can be filled with water from a nearby stream or lake. Finally, think about the durability of the shower. Will it hold up well in outdoor conditions? Look for a shower made from sturdy materials that can withstand rough handling and exposure to the elements.

Here is a table summarizing the key considerations for portable showers:

Consideration Description
Size and Weight Lightweight and compact for easy transport
Water Capacity Determines how long you can shower before refilling
Water Source Can be hooked up to a water source or filled manually
Durability Made from sturdy materials for outdoor use

Remember, choosing the right portable shower is essential for a comfortable and convenient camping experience.

Setting Up Your Camping Shower

Finding the Perfect Location

When choosing the perfect location for your camping shower, there are a few factors to consider. Privacy is important, so look for a spot that is secluded and away from other campers. Additionally, consider the terrain of the area. A flat and level surface will make it easier to set up and use the shower. It's also important to be mindful of water sources. Look for a location that is close to a water source, such as a river or lake, to make refilling the shower easier.

Assembling and Installing the Shower

Once you have all the necessary components for your camping shower, it's time to assemble and install it. Follow these steps to ensure a smooth setup:

  1. Start by connecting the showerhead to the water source. Make sure it is securely attached to prevent any leaks.

  2. Attach the hose to the showerhead and the water source. Double-check that the connections are tight to avoid any water loss.

  3. If your camping shower requires a pump, connect it to the water source and ensure it is properly primed.

  4. Set up the shower enclosure or privacy tent in a suitable location. Make sure it provides enough space for comfortable showering.

  5. Hang the showerhead at a convenient height, ensuring it is within reach but not too low.

Remember to test the shower before using it to ensure everything is working properly. Enjoy your refreshing shower experience in the great outdoors!

Tips for a Refreshing Shower Experience

Conserving Water while Showering

When camping, it's important to conserve water while showering to minimize your impact on the environment. Here are some tips to help you save water:

  1. Time your showers: Limit your shower time to a few minutes to reduce water usage.
  2. Use a low-flow showerhead: Invest in a showerhead that is designed to conserve water without compromising water pressure.
  3. Collect and reuse water: Place a bucket or basin under the shower to collect water for other purposes, such as washing dishes or watering plants.

Tip: Remember, every drop counts when you're camping in nature!

Maintaining Hygiene in the Outdoors

When camping in the great outdoors, it's important to prioritize hygiene to stay healthy and comfortable. Here are some tips to help you maintain cleanliness during your camping trip:

  1. Pack biodegradable soap and toiletries to minimize your impact on the environment. Look for products that are specifically designed for outdoor use.

  2. Use hand sanitizer frequently, especially before handling food or after using the restroom. This will help prevent the spread of germs and keep you and your fellow campers safe.

  3. Dispose of waste properly by using designated trash bins or packing out your trash. This includes used toiletries, sanitary products, and any other waste generated during your camping trip.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use a camping shower with hot water?

Yes, there are camping showers available that can heat water for a warm shower. Look for showers with built-in water heaters or ones that can be connected to a portable hot water source.

How much water does a camping shower use?

The water usage of a camping shower can vary depending on the type and settings. On average, a camping shower can use around 1-2 gallons of water per minute.

Are camping showers easy to set up?

Yes, most camping showers are designed to be easy to set up. They often come with detailed instructions and require minimal tools or equipment for assembly.

Can I use soap and shampoo with a camping shower?

Yes, you can use soap and shampoo with a camping shower. However, it is important to use biodegradable and environmentally-friendly products to minimize impact on the outdoor environment.

How do I maintain and clean a camping shower?

To maintain and clean a camping shower, rinse it thoroughly after each use and allow it to dry completely before storing. Regularly clean the showerhead and other components with mild soap and water.

Are camping showers safe to use?

Camping showers are generally safe to use when used properly. However, it is important to follow safety guidelines, such as ensuring the shower is stable and secure, using non-slip mats, and avoiding hot water burns.
